Why Are Omega-3 and Omega-6 Important?

Omega-3 and Omega-6 are polyunsaturated fatty acids (PUFAs) that play key roles in:

  • Brain function and mental health

  • Heart health – reducing triglycerides and inflammation

  • Joint mobility – reducing stiffness and pain

  • Immune response – balancing inflammation

  • Skin health – maintaining barrier function and hydration

While both are essential, a healthy Omega-6:Omega-3 ratio is crucial. Modern Western diets often contain too much Omega-6 (from vegetable oils and processed foods) and not enough Omega-3 (from oily fish, flax, walnuts), leading to a pro-inflammatory state.


What This Test Measures

Our at-home test analyses your blood sample for:

  • Omega-3 Index – the percentage of EPA + DHA in red blood cell membranes

  • Omega-6 Levels – including linoleic acid and arachidonic acid

  • Omega-6:Omega-3 Ratio – an important indicator of inflammation risk

  • Total Polyunsaturated Fatty Acid Profile – to help optimise dietary balance

Frequently Asked Questions About Omega-3 & Omega-6 Blood Tests

1. What does an Omega-3 / Omega-6 blood test measure?
This test measures your Omega-3 index, Omega-6 levels, and your Omega-6:Omega-3 ratio. Together, these markers indicate whether you are getting enough Omega-3 fatty acids and whether your fatty acid balance supports healthy inflammation levels.

2. Why is the Omega-6:Omega-3 ratio important?
Both Omega-3 and Omega-6 are essential, but an imbalance (too much Omega-6, too little Omega-3) can lead to chronic inflammation. A healthy ratio supports heart health, brain function, and overall wellbeing.

5. What happens if my results are out of range?
Your report will include guidance on how to improve your results. This may include increasing Omega-3-rich foods like salmon, mackerel, flax, chia seeds, or considering supplementation.

6. How often should I re-test my Omega-3 levels?
If you change your diet or start supplementation, it is recommended to retest every 3–6 months to monitor improvement and ensure you are reaching optimal Omega-3 levels.
